How much do construction science j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 2, 2026, the average yearly pay for construction science in Raleigh, NC is $84,025.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$62,700.00 and $102,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is construction science?

A Construction Science job involves managing and overseeing construction projects by applying engineering, technology, and management principles. Professionals in this field work on project planning, scheduling, budgeting, safety compliance, and quality control. They collaborate with architects, engineers, and contractors to ensure that projects are completed efficiently and according to specifications. Careers in Construction Science can include construction managers, estimators, project engineers, and site supervisors.

What are some typical career paths or advancement opportunities for professionals with a background in construction science?

Professionals with a background in Construction Science often start in entry-level roles such as project engineer, field coordinator, or assistant project manager. With experience, they can advance to senior positions like project manager, construction superintendent, or even director of construction. There are also opportunities to specialize in areas such as estimating, scheduling, or safety management, or to move into related fields like real estate development or consulting. The industry values both technical expertise and leadership skills, making continuing education and on-the-job learning important for career growth.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in construction science, and why are they important?

To excel in Construction Science, a strong background in construction management principles, engineering fundamentals, and project planning is usually required, often supported by a bachelor's degree in construction science or a related field. Familiarity with construction management software (like Procore or AutoCAD), safety certifications (such as OSHA), and building codes is important. Excellent problem-solving, teamwork, and communication skills set candidates apart, as effective collaboration with diverse teams is common. These skills and credentials are critical for ensuring projects are completed safely, efficiently, and to industry standards.

Is a construction science degree worth it?

A construction science degree prepares individuals for roles in construction management, estimating, and project planning, often leading to higher-paying positions and career advancement. The degree provides knowledge of building codes, safety regulations, and project coordination, which are valuable in the construction industry.

What do construction science professionals do?

Construction science professionals plan, coordinate, and oversee construction projects, ensuring they are completed on time, within budget, and according to specifications. They often use project management tools, analyze blueprints, and collaborate with architects, engineers, and contractors throughout the construction process.

What to do with a construction science degree?

A construction science degree prepares individuals for roles such as construction manager, project engineer, or site supervisor, involving planning, coordination, and oversight of construction projects. Graduates often work in construction firms, government agencies, or consulting firms, utilizing skills in project management, safety protocols, and construction technology. Certifications like OSHA or PMP can enhance job prospects in this field.

Responsibilities

As a Danis Estimator youโ€™ll:

Provide Input from Start to Finish: Review proposal requirements, provide risk analysis input, determine scopes of work and required contents of estimate. Provide early input on selfโ€‘perform trades to determine field manpower requirements and availability.

Bring Vision to Life: Generate conceptual, selfโ€‘perform, hard bid, and GMP estimates for a wide range of complex projects.

Beyond Square Foot Estimating: Utilize historical data from past projects, subcontracts, and productivity analyses to create and refine detailed quantity takeoff and manโ€‘hour based estimates.

Ensure Seamless Collaboration: Serve as a dependable resource, supporting preconstruction by assisting in constructability reviews, schedule input, value analysis, and the pursuit of target value delivery.

Qualifications

As an Estimator youโ€™ll bring:

Educational Background: Civil Engineering, CM or other construction related degree or equivalent combinations of technical training and/or related experience is preferred.

Experience: A minimum of 5 years construction operations experience in the commercial construction industry.

Project Expertise: At least 3 years of experience estimating projects with values up to $50 mil in the commercial and institutional domains. Selfโ€‘perform, atโ€‘risk GC/CM background is preferred. Ability to estimate the following types of projects is a plus: hospitals/healthcare facilities, corporate office, retail, university, parking garages, assisted living, data centers, advanced mfg., food & beverage mfg., and Life Sciences.

Process Proficiency: Knowledge of estimating techniques, engineering disciplines, and cost control systems.
